presentation of the XU 2012
the Zero XU is a lightweight, innovative electric motorcycle that blends cutting-edge technology, performance and practicality to become the benchmark for urban commuting. A low saddle, no gears, removable battery, and optional luggage allow riders to tackle the city with a new sense of freedom.
ride the way you like. Turn the handlebars to the right, relax and cruise from destination to destination. Or... hop along sidewalks, accelerate around bends, get back in line, cut through traffic. Designed to combine utility with pure pleasure, the Zero XU transforms the city into a biker's theme park. It's ideal for everyday use...but especially for dynamic city dwellers who sometimes want to push their limits.
Built around an aircraft-style aluminum chassis, the Zero XU's minimalist styling is chunky, eye-catching and comfortable. With a removable battery and the option of a stand-alone charger, urban bikers can recharge anywhere. As with all Zero models, the 2012 Zero XU costs just pennies to recharge, and with its maintenance-free powertrain, it's one of the most economical motorcycles to ride.
what's new - 2012
the Zero XU 2012 features a completely new powertrain. The increased power translates into +75% range per charge, improved top speed (+25%), and energy recuperation during braking. It improves the life cycle and offers virtually zero maintenance costs. Capable of reaching speeds of up to 104 km/h, the new Zero XU also benefits from a wider range of available power for even more fun urban travel. With the new battery and cell configuration, combined with the brushless motor, the Zero XU accepts 3,000 charging cycles, and approximately 160,000 km without any powertrain overhaul. Finally, the belt drive is both maintenance-free and silent, as on the Zero S and Zero DS.
revised geometry and new, re-sized brake discs improve handling and braking performance. Visually, the 2012 Zero XU stands out from its predecessor with a black anodized aluminum chassis.

Specifications Zero Motorcycles XU 2012
- Chassis
- Frame : steel perimeter
- Seat height : 800 mm (31.50 in)
- Wheelbase : 1,397 mm (55 in)
- Weight when fully loaded : 100 kg (220 lb)
- Front axle
- Reverse telehydraulic fork Ø 38 mm, Wheel travel : 135 mm (5.31 in)
- Braking 1 disc Ø 220 mm (8.66 in), 2-piston caliper
- Front tire : 90 / 90 - 19 → Order this type of tire
- Transmission
- single stage gearbox
- Secondary belt drive
- Rear axle
- Mono-damper, Wheel travel : 141 mm (5.55 in)
- Braking 1 disc Ø 220 mm (8.66 in), single-piston caliper
- Rear tire : 110 / 90 - 16 → Order this type of tire
- Motor
- Electric longitudinal
- Battery Li-Ion
- Cooling system : liquid
